Solar power was first discovered by French physicist Edmond Becquerel in 1839 at the young age of 19. Solar energy was not "invented" by a single person; its history includes key discoveries and innovations over centuries. Before the first modern solar panels were invented by Bell Laboratories in 1954, the history of solar energy was one of fits and starts, driven by individual inventors and scientists.

The integrated containerized photovoltaic inverter station centralizes the key equipment required for grid-connected solar power systems — including AC/DC distribution, inverters, monitoring, and communication units — all housed within a specially designed, sealed container.
